专为 Node.js 设计的 DevOps 服务和工具的广泛生态系统进一步增强了其集成能力。 总而言之,Django 和 Node.js 都提供了重要的生态系统和集成兼容性。Django 提供了一个更成熟、更结构化的环境,其中包含许多插件和库。凭借庞大且快速发展的社区,Node.js 为各种使用场景提供了灵活性和大量模块选择。您的特定项目要求...
Spring Boot 基于Java,虽然它简化了 Spring 框架的配置,但由于 Java 语言本身的复杂性,开发速度相比 Django 和 Node.js 略显缓慢。然而,Spring Boot 提供了高度可扩展的架构,适合长期大型项目。 3. Node.js Node.js 使用 JavaScript 进行后端开发,使得前后端统一,减少了语言切换的成本。加上 npm 生态系统中大量...
Node.js是一个基于Chrome V8引擎的JavaScript运行环境,支持非阻塞I/O和事件驱动,使其在处理大量并发请求时表现出色;Django是一个高级Python Web框架,它鼓励快速开发和干净的、实用的设计,内置了大量实用的功能,如用户身份验证、内容管理以及数据库迁移工具等。对于需要高并发处理和实时交互功能的应用,Node.js可能是更好...
答:Node.js是一个基于JavaScript的运行时环境,允许在服务器端运行JavaScript代码。它非常适合构建实时应用和高并发应用。而Django是一个用Python编写的高级Web框架,它遵循MVC(模型-视图-控制器)模式,包含了一个ORM(对象关系映射)系统,以及许多用于快速开发的工具和功能。总的来说,Node.js提供了更多的灵活性和控制力,...
Django vs Node.js Django 和 Node.js 之间的争论具有挑战性,因为 Node.js 是基于 Chrome 的 V8 JavaScript 引擎的 JavaScript 运行时,而 Django 是一个 Web 框架。换句话说,Django 是一个相当繁重的框架,并提供了许多开箱即用的基本任务的方法,但 Node.js 是一个提供大量库的平台。
标准,也完全支持 ECMAScript 标准。Node.js 环境下用 js语言编写的文件,有三种格式:.js、.mjs、...
Node.js(GitHub上的55,432★)和Django(GitHub上的37,614★)是构建Web应用程序的两个强大工具。 Node.js有一个“JavaScript无处不在”的动机,以确保在Web应用程序的服务器端和客户端使用JavaScript,Django有一个“完美主义者框架,有最后期限”的动机,以帮助开发人员快速构建应用程序。 它们正在许多大型项目中实施,它...
考虑到NodeJS的流行,我们在Flask vs. Node部分下提供了Flask和Node的惊人对比。在以下功能上评估Django和Flask将帮助您选择一个。 2. 实验要点 学习和掌握Flask与Django的区别 学习和掌握Flask与NodeJS的区别 Flask VS Django 默认Admin管理 这两个框架都提供了一个引导管理应用程序。在Django中,它是内置的,并带有...
我的理解:node.js集成了v8解析引擎、服务器等可以说是一个开发环境;相当于 php + apache.选择了node...
它用于构建 API 和在线应用程序,被认为是标准的 Node.js 服务器框架。Node.js 是一个支持全栈的 JavaScript 后端。这是节省时间和金钱的绝佳方式。 Node.js 使用的 V8 JavaScript 引擎加速了基于 JavaScript 的代码到机器代码的转换,并使代码实现更简单。一般来说,Express.js 提供了几个 Node.js 最流行的功能。